8-K: Webstar Technology Group Announces Major Restructuring and New Leadership
Current Report
Webstar Technology Group has undergone a significant transformation, including a change in control, new leadership appointments, and strategic acquisitions.
Summary
- Webstar Technology Group has experienced a change in control with the acquisition of 100% of its Series A Preferred Stock by a group of investors.
- This acquisition resulted in the resignation of the previous officers and directors.
- A new management team has been appointed, including Ricardo Haynes as Chairman/CEO, Marilyn Karpoff and Gordon Clinkscale as Independent Directors, Eric Collins as President, Lance Lehr as COO, and Donald Keer as Secretary.
- The company has entered into three material definitive agreements.
- Webstar acquired contracts from Electrical and Compression Optimization, Inc. (ECO) in exchange for 201,057,278 ECO common shares to be distributed to Webstar shareholders.
- Webstar acquired licenses for Gigabyte Slayer and WARP-G software from Webnet Technologies Incorporated, eliminating $3,237,660 in debt.
- Webstar also acquired assets and intellectual property related to Bear Village, Inc. family resort developments from Thunder Energies Corporation, including XXXX RORA Prime cryptocurrency.

Management Changes
| Role | Previous Person | New Person | Effective Date | Reason |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Chairman/CEO | James Owens | Ricardo Haynes | June 14, 2024 | Change of control |
| Independent Director | Sanford Simon | Marilyn Karpoff | June 14, 2024 | Change of control |
| Independent Director | Don Roberts | Gordon Clinkscale | June 14, 2024 | Change of control |
| President | James Owens | Eric Collins | June 14, 2024 | Change of control |
| CFO | Michael Hendrickson | Adrienne Anderson (transitional) | June 14, 2024 | Change of control |
| Secretary | Adrienne Anderson | Donald R. Keer | June 14, 2024 | Change of control |
| COO | James Owens | Lance Lehr | June 14, 2024 | Change of control |

Key Dates
| Date | Description |
|---|---|
| June 14, 2024 | The date the new investors acquired 100% of the Series A Preferred Stock. |
| June 21, 2024 | The date Webstar entered into agreements with ECO and Webnet. |
| June 24, 2024 | The date Webstar acquired assets from Thunder Energies Corporation. |
| June 26, 2024 | The date the report was signed. |
